The Role of APIs in Contemporary Slot Game Ecosystems

Application Programming Interfaces (APIs) serve as the digital backbone connecting various components of an online casino platform. They enable disparate systems—game servers, random number generators (RNG), player accounts, and analytics tools—to communicate efficiently. In slot game development, APIs are crucial for:

  • Real-time game data exchange: Keeping game states synchronized across platforms.
  • Dynamic content delivery: Updating game features, bonuses, and jackpots without redeploying applications.
  • Regulatory compliance: Ensuring transparency and auditable transaction logs.
  • Continuous game evolution: Incorporating player feedback and analytics into game mechanics seamlessly.

Technical Breakdown of “Bow of Artemis API Calls”

Functionality Description
Start Spin Triggers a new game round, returning reel positions, winnings, and game state data.
Fetch Game State Provides the current status of an ongoing game, including active bonuses or jackpots.
Bet Adjustment Allows players to modify their wager; the API recalculates potential payouts accordingly.
Retrieve Paytable Returns detailed payout information for symbol combinations, crucial for transparent gameplay.
Bonus Feature Activation Handles special bonus triggers, ensuring that complexities like multipliers and free spins activate accurately.

These API calls exemplify a layered, flexible approach to slot game mechanics that not only enhance user experience but also ensure adherence to regulatory and technical standards.
